1.1.5-RC2
I have a single node
in which I have a replication environment installed, and a replication set
defined, but with no subscribers to the node. As I add data, the sl_log_1 table
keeps getting larger. I see messages in the slon log that the cleanup thread is
running, but it is not deleting from the log table.
Trying to track this
down, I'm extracting sql statements from the cleanup thread code to try running
against the database, but I can't seem to get the syntax correct for a SELECT
statement with "where log_xid = x" - I get errors about not being able to cast
xid to integer, etc. - I'm looking in the event table to get these xids, but I
clearly need to cast them somehow to work in the query, and I can't figure out
how to do this. This is probably a generic postgres usage question, but I'm
trying to track down the problem mentioned above, so any hints would be
appreciated.
